  • Model: Dufour 460 GL
  • Year: 2018
  • Maximum capacity: 8 people approx.
  • Cabins: 4
  • Bathrooms: 4
  • Length: 14,15 m
  • Beam: 4,50 m
  • Draft: 1,95-2,20 m depending on keel

Charter starts at €2,500/week. Before dates are confirmed, the quote should show what is included and what is paid separately: fuel, final cleaning, berths, skipper when requested and deposit. A written breakdown makes it possible to compare the real cost of the break.

Useful questions before booking Lola Dufour 460 GL for the route between Rava and Dugi Otok

How is the overnight place near Rava chosen? · Rava · travellers interested in coastal villages

The choice depends on shelter, holding, draft, night wind, services and availability. A harbour offers showers and dinner; a buoy reduces manoeuvring; anchoring brings quiet in stable conditions. On Lola Dufour 460 GL, the skipper decides while there is enough daylight and keeps a second option. A berth may be reserved in high season without losing an alternative if the outlook changes.
